US FOREST SERVICE SELLS OUT PUBLIC LANDS IN BOUQUET CANYON

Big Government | Big Business | Identity Theft | Illegal Immigration | Abuse | Property Rights | Terrorism | Gangs | Legal Help

Towers & LinesiIS THIS WHAT YOU WANT YOUR FOREST TO LOOK LIKE?

Angeles National Forest Supervisor, Jody Noiron, (pictured) is taking responsibility for selling out your National Forest to Southern California Edison. The proposed project is a new Power corridor consisting of several miles of High Power 500kV Transmission Lines. Noiron is has approved locating the Lines the length of Bouquet Canyon, through virgin land, recreational land and across the public roadways within a few hundred feet of quaint cabins, homes and the Big Oaks restaurant which was built in the 1920s. The USFS 50-year lease to Edison would bring in untold revenue at the expense of creating significant fire and environmental threat to both people and habitat, according to the government's own Environmental Impact Report. Supervisor Noiron and staff failed to clearly notify the cabin permit holders and private property inholders within the Angeles National Forest of the impending project. She and her staff excluded these inholders' properties from maps misrepresenting the impact of the project on the Forest and surrounding communities.

Who profits from this sell-out? General Electric, Southern California Edison, the USFS and the Wind Industry, primarily. Sources say the California Public Utilities Commission is maneuvering politically to preserve its agency's power over the Federal Energy Commission and its comprehensive national energy corridors plans. Fire Threat Looms Larger to Communities if Transmission Lines Surround Bouquet Canyon Reservoir

Wildfire Can Travel to Neighboring Communities As Fast As 1 Mile Every 15 Seconds.

Acton, Aqua Dulce, Canyon Country, Junniper Hills, Leona Valley, Lake Hughes, Green Valley, Palmdale and Santa Clarita are all in harm's way.

Helicopter While several communities successfully fought Transmission Lines coming directly through their neighborhoods, Alternative 2 is in everybody's backyard. Fires that start in Bouquet Canyon will no longer be able to be fought as in the past according to the Final EIR Report. Fatal electrical currents can be conducted via smoke, water mist and retardant to fire-fighting air and ground crews. Because of firefighters' concern of electrocution, fires that start in proximity to the Lines will be allowed to grow larger before they can be suppressed away from the Lines. And fires can more likely grow out of control, raging over the hills to neighboring communities, producing what could be the most catastrophic wildfire losses ever seen in the area. This can lead to more homes and structures in the Canyon being consumed by fire that otherwise might have been saved, and an increased risk of lives being lost.

super scooper

Fire-fighting Super Scoopers will be at increased risk with Transmission Lines towering hundreds of feet in the air across their flight path. Bouquet Reservoir is valuable fire-fighting resource and has been critical in saving the Canyon and its surrounding comnmunities. The Los Angeles County Fire Department originally came out against the Alternative 2 Transmission Line Route, but for some unknown reason is now willing to adjust its flight paths instead of having the lines moved, which they could easily have done. Instead, they are requesting large orange balls be attached to the Lines so that pilots can see them better to hopefully avoid collisions during fire-fighting maneuvers. The question remains, why would the Fire Department allow the hazard at all when the lines could have been placed out of harm's way? All they had to do was ask, according to Edison and the California Public Utilites Commission.
